hallo multi-node operators! today’s release will include a withdraw all rewards button. we hope this will aid in a smoother harvest :wink:

re loading times - the main Node list will now only reload on refresh/after actions are taken, so moving in and out of Node detail screens to check statuses etc. should be fairly quick. more generally, performance upgrades are ongoing, and we should see continued improvement all-round when it comes to speed and responsiveness.

Hello everyone! Thank you for giving feedback on App v.3, and for all your ideas and support.

Very pleased to report that we’ve delivered what we set out to do here. In addition, pUniswap and pKyber are back! The app will now choose the best pool based on liquidity, exchange rate, and fees. Next, we’ll also be adding slippage information and an improved trade detail screen (with the exact amount received).

We’ve created a new proposal detailing these improvements among others, very unimaginatively titled App v.4. Head over to follow what’s coming next - pDEX improvements, support for community builders, our very own cold storage solution, etc.
